The Transition from Wooden Ships to Steel-hulled Vessels in the 20th Century

The 20th century marked a significant transformation in maritime technology, particularly in the transition from traditional wooden ships to steel-hulled vessels. This change revolutionized naval architecture, commercial shipping, and naval warfare, shaping the modern maritime industry.

Early Wooden Ships and Their Limitations

For centuries, wooden ships were the backbone of maritime transportation. They were constructed primarily from timber, which was abundant and relatively easy to work with. However, wooden ships had inherent limitations:

  • Susceptibility to rot and marine organisms
  • Limited size and durability
  • Vulnerability to fire and damage
  • Heavier and less stable compared to metal ships

The Rise of Steel-Hulled Vessels

In the late 19th and early 20th centuries, advancements in metallurgy and engineering led to the development of steel-hulled ships. Steel offered many advantages over wood:

  • Greater strength and durability
  • Ability to build larger ships with more cargo capacity
  • Improved resistance to fire and marine damage
  • Reduced maintenance and longer service life

Impact on Maritime Industry and Warfare

The shift to steel ships had profound effects:

  • Enabled the construction of massive cargo ships and battleships, transforming global trade and naval power
  • Facilitated technological innovations such as steam turbines and later, diesel engines
  • Led to the decline of traditional shipbuilding skills focused on wood
  • Contributed to the rapid expansion of naval fleets during World Wars I and II
